The theory does not forbid a node from having no causal effect on anything else, which is what I think an epiphenomenal consciousness would be. But such a node could not be measured. A logical positivist would say this makes the theory meaningless, and I’m inclined to agree.
Conceivably, if the universe runs on a computer, there could be a node which cannot be measured from inside the universe but could be measured from outside. Perhaps debug info is turned on, and any time neurons fire in patterns that match some regex, the word “consciousness” is printed to stderr. I would not say this is meaningless; if it is true, it gives us a way of communicating with whoever is watching stderr (but no guarantee that such a being exists or would talk back).
But it is not suitable as a theory of consciousness, unless you want to stipulate that neurons write about consciousness for reasons that are completely uncorrelated to consciousness.
